As technological advancements reshape industries and job markets evolve, obtaining the right certifications has become essential for career growth. The future favors those who continuously upskill and adapt to emerging trends. Whether you are a student, working professional, or entrepreneur, acquiring future-proof certifications can provide a competitive edge. In this article, we delve into the most promising certificate courses of the future, their significance, and their potential impact on career progression.
The global job market is becoming increasingly competitive, and employers are prioritizing candidates with specialized skills. Certificate programs offer a cost-effective and efficient way to gain expertise in specific domains. Unlike traditional degrees, they focus on practical skills and industry-relevant knowledge, making them ideal for career advancement.
Fast-track Career Growth: Gain in-demand skills in a shorter time frame.
Affordability: More cost-effective than full-time degree programs.
Flexibility: Many programs are available online, allowing self-paced learning.
Industry Recognition: Certifications from reputed institutions enhance credibility.
Higher Salary Potential: Certified professionals often earn higher salaries than their non-certified peers.
Several industries are witnessing rapid digital transformation, leading to an increased demand for certified professionals. Some of the key industries where certificate courses play a crucial role include:
Technology & IT (Cybersecurity, Cloud Computing, Data Science)
Healthcare & Medical Fields (Telemedicine, Clinical Research, Healthcare Management)
Business & Management (Project Management, Agile Leadership, Business Analytics)
Finance & Investment (Financial Analysis, Blockchain, Cryptocurrency)
Digital Marketing & E-commerce (SEO, PPC, Social Media Marketing)
Engineering & Manufacturing (Robotics, Industry 4.0, Sustainable Manufacturing)
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ning (Deep Learning, AI Ethics, Computer Vision)
Sustainability & Green Technologies (Renewable Energy, Carbon Footprint Management)
